This article aims to demystify the relay datasheet, offering a comprehensive guide to help engineers and hobbyists alike understand and utilize this vital resource effectively.<\/p>\n<p style=\"font-size: 16px;\">\u3000\u3000**Understanding the Basics of a Relay Datasheet**<\/p>\n<p style=\"font-size: 16px;\">\u3000\u3000A relay datasheet is a technical document that outlines the specifications and characteristics of a relay. Relays are electromagnetic switches that control the flow of electric current using an electromagnet. They are widely used in various applications, including automotive, industrial, and consumer electronics.<\/p>\n<p style=\"font-size: 16px;\">\u3000\u3000The datasheet typically includes the following key components:<\/p>\n<p style=\"font-size: 16px;\">\u3000\u3000- **General Description**: This section provides an overview of the relay, including its type, dimensions, and weight.<br \/>\n&#8211; **Electrical Characteristics**: This section details the relay&#8217;s electrical specifications, such as coil voltage, contact ratings, and insulation resistance.<br \/>\n&#8211; **Operating Characteristics**: This section describes the relay&#8217;s performance under different operating conditions, including contact bounce, pull-in and drop-out voltages, and operating life.<br \/>\n&#8211; **Mechanical Characteristics**: This section outlines the relay&#8217;s physical specifications, such as the contact arrangement, coil wire size, and mounting type.<br \/>\n&#8211; **Environmental Specifications**: This section provides information about the relay&#8217;s operating temperature range, humidity, and vibration resistance.<\/p>\n<p style=\"font-size: 16px;\">\u3000\u3000**Interpreting the Electrical Characteristics**<\/p>\n<p style=\"font-size: 16px;\">\u3000\u3000The electrical characteristics section is a critical part of the relay datasheet, as it determines the relay&#8217;s suitability for a specific application. Here are some key parameters to consider:<\/p>\n<p style=\"font-size: 16px;\">\u3000\u3000- **Coil Voltage**: This is the voltage required to activate the relay. It is essential to choose a relay with a coil voltage that matches the available supply voltage.<br \/>\n&#8211; **Contact Ratings**: This includes the maximum current and voltage that the relay can handle without causing damage. It is crucial to ensure that the relay&#8217;s contact ratings are sufficient for the intended application.<br \/>\n&#8211; **Insulation Resistance**: This parameter indicates the relay&#8217;s ability to prevent electrical leakage between its contacts and other components. A higher insulation resistance value is preferable.<\/p>\n<p style=\"font-size: 16px;\">\u3000\u3000**Understanding the Operating Characteristics**<\/p>\n<p style=\"font-size: 16px;\">\u3000\u3000The operating characteristics section provides valuable information about the relay&#8217;s performance under various conditions. Here are some important parameters to consider:<\/p>\n<p style=\"font-size: 16px;\">\u3000\u3000- **Contact Bounce**: This refers to the temporary contact disconnection that occurs when the relay switches on or off. A lower bounce time is desirable for applications that require precise control.<br \/>\n&#8211; **Pull-in and Drop-out Voltages**: These parameters indicate the voltages at which the relay switches on and off, respectively. It is essential to ensure that the relay operates within the specified voltage range.<br \/>\n&#8211; **Operating Life**: This parameter indicates the number of times the relay can switch on and off before it fails. A longer operating life is preferable for applications that require frequent switching.<\/p>\n<p style=\"font-size: 16px;\">\u3000\u3000**Applications of Relay Datasheets**<\/p>\n<p style=\"font-size: 16px;\">\u3000\u3000Relay datasheets are essential for selecting the right relay for a specific application.
